On the night of 23 January 1904, a devastating fire swept through Ålesund, destroying over eight hundred wooden buildings and leaving ten thousand people homeless in the depths of a Norwegian winter. The reconstruction that followed, completed in just three years with financial aid from Kaiser Wilhelm II of Germany (a regular visitor to the region's fjords), created one of Europe's most remarkable concentrations of Art Nouveau architecture. Turrets, spires, dragon motifs, and floral ornamentation in stone and plaster transform this fishing town's waterfront into an open-air museum of Jugendstil design — a Nordic interpretation of the international movement that drew inspiration from Norwegian fairy tales, Viking mythology, and the organic forms of the surrounding natural landscape.

Ålesund occupies a series of islands at the mouth of the Storfjord, giving it a dramatic setting of harbour channels, bridges, and waterfront promenades backed by distant snow-capped mountains. The town centre clusters on the islands of Aspøya and Nørvøya, connected by bridges and framing a narrow canal that fills with fishing boats and pleasure craft. The Aksla viewpoint, reached by climbing 418 steps from the town park, rewards the effort with one of Norway's great panoramas — a bird's-eye view of the Art Nouveau rooftops, the island-studded coastline, and the Sunnmøre Alps rising from the fjord. The Jugendstilsenteret (Art Nouveau Centre), housed in a beautifully restored 1905 pharmacy, provides context for the architectural treasures that surround it.

Norwegian coastal cuisine reaches refined heights in Ålesund. Klippfisk (dried and salted cod), the town's historic export, is prepared in Portuguese-influenced dishes — bacalau à Gomes de Sá, with potatoes and olives, is a local favourite. Fresh Atlantic cod, haddock, and halibut appear simply grilled or in creamy fish soups. The town's proximity to rich fishing grounds means that king crab, lobster, and scallops are reliably fresh. For a unique Ålesund experience, visit the Molja Lighthouse, a harbour restaurant set in a functioning lighthouse, where seafood is served with views of the fishing fleet returning at dusk. Brown cheese (brunost), that peculiarly Norwegian caramel-sweet whey cheese, accompanies breakfast waffles throughout the region.

The fjord landscape surrounding Ålesund is among Norway's most spectacular. The Geirangerfjord, a UNESCO World Heritage Site reached by a two-hour drive over mountain passes, is flanked by waterfalls — the Seven Sisters and the Suitor — cascading hundreds of metres into emerald water. The Hjørundfjord, less visited but equally beautiful, penetrates deep into the Sunnmøre Alps and is accessible by a scenic ferry. Bird Island (Runde), home to half a million seabirds including puffins, gannets, and kittiwakes, lies a short boat ride south. The Atlantic Road, a highway linking islands via eight bridges over open sea, is considered one of the world's most beautiful drives.

Ålesund welcomes AIDA, Ambassador Cruise Line, Azamara, Celebrity Cruises, Costa Cruises, Fred Olsen Cruise Lines, Hapag-Lloyd Cruises, Holland America Line, Hurtigruten, MSC Cruises, Norwegian Cruise Line, Oceania Cruises, Ponant, Princess Cruises, Regent Seven Seas Cruises, Saga Ocean Cruises, Scenic Ocean Cruises, Silversea, TUI Cruises Mein Schiff, Viking, and Windstar Cruises. Nearby ports include Geiranger, Bergen, and Molde. The cruise season runs from May through September, with June and July offering the midnight sun and the best chances of clear skies for fjord viewing.
